Ibrahim Pasha of Egypt - Muhammad Ali was appointed governor of the Morea
Time: 1824
Place: Peloponnese, Greece
Details: In 1824, Muhammad Ali was appointed governor of the Morea (the Peloponnese peninsula in southern Greece) by Ottoman Sultan Mahmud II.
